TFLO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2023 in Review

524 of the 6,859 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in iShares Treasury Floating Rate Bond ETF (TFLO) for Q4 2023, worth a combined $8.76B — up 1.9% from $8.61B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 106 funds opened new TFLO positions and 30 closed out — a net gain of 76 holders — while 193 added to existing stakes and 215 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Morgan Stanley, adding an estimated $364M. The largest seller was Osaic Holdings, cutting an estimated $93.6M.
